#8ef338 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8ef338 is composed of 55.7% red, 95.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 77%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 92.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 58.6%. #8ef338 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#1de700.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#8ef338 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8ef338 has RGB values of R:142, G:243,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 9368376.

Shades and Tints of #8ef338
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020400 is the darkest color, while #f7fef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8ef338
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959a91 is the less saturated color, while #8dfb30 is the most saturated one.
